锁定要在横向(仅横向)objective-C中启动的视图

锁定要在横向(仅横向)objective-C中启动的视图,objective-c,view,ios7,landscape,Objective C,View,Ios7,Landscape,我想首先启动一个仅在横向模式下的视图控制器,而其他视图和整个应用程序可以在纵向和横向模式下工作。我如何在iOS 7中做到这一点?谢谢。因此,您的整个应用程序可能支持所有方向,但一个视图控制器只需要是横向的 您可以轻松停止横向视图控制器从横向旋转到纵向,但当应用程序已经处于纵向时,很难强制设备旋转,因为这与iPhone制造商的原则相矛盾 事实上,当你知道诀窍的时候,其实并不难。请看我对这个类似问题的回答。

我想首先启动一个仅在横向模式下的视图控制器,而其他视图和整个应用程序可以在纵向和横向模式下工作。我如何在iOS 7中做到这一点?谢谢。

因此,您的整个应用程序可能支持所有方向,但一个视图控制器只需要是横向的

您可以轻松停止横向视图控制器从横向旋转到纵向,但当应用程序已经处于纵向时,很难强制设备旋转,因为这与iPhone制造商的原则相矛盾

事实上,当你知道诀窍的时候,其实并不难。请看我对这个类似问题的回答。